Eat your way through San Antonio while learning about local architecture with this tour, which combines a traditional cultural tour with a food tour. You'll visit historic buildings, some of which double as modern eateries, take a walk through the King William Historic District, and make plenty of stops along the way to sample everything from ceviche to champagne, all with an expert local guide to lead the way.
